    After update to 5.1.8 the following message appears in wp dashboard:

    basedir restriction in effect. File(/wp-config.php) is not within the allowed path(s): … wp-security-firewall-utility.php on line 82

    It doesn’t seem to appear afterwards. Is this something to be worried about?

    @anchises

    The firewall runs before any WordPress code so the old firewall code would run at least once before the update happened.

    If it only happened once and the bootstrap file version says?1.0.2, then it’s fine nothing to worry about.
